Q1In a survey of 180 people, 72 people preferred tea. Assertion: The percentage of people who preferred tea was 40%. Reason: Percentage share is calculated as part ÷ total × 100. Choose the correct option.

A Both the assertion and the reason are true, and the reason correctly explains the assertion.
B Both the assertion and the reason are true, but the reason does not explain the assertion.
C The assertion is true, but the reason is false.
D The assertion is false, but the reason is true.
Explanation

Use the percentage formula given in the reason: percentage share = part ÷ total × 100. Here, the part is 72 people and the total is 180 people. So, percentage = 72 ÷ 180 × 100. Since 72/180 = 2/5 = 0.4, the percentage is 0.4 × 100 = 40%. Thus, the assertion is true. The reason states the same formula that proves the assertion, so it correctly explains it. Therefore, option A is correct.

Q2In a coaching library, the number of books issued on Monday, Tuesday, Wednesday and Thursday was 45, 60, 75 and 90 respectively. Which statement is correct?

A The average number of books issued per day was 67.5.
B The average number of books issued per day was 65.
C The total number of books issued was 255.
D Thursday had 15 fewer issued books than Wednesday.
Explanation

Add the four daily figures first: 45 + 60 + 75 + 90 = 270. The average is total number of books issued ÷ number of days. Here, average = 270 ÷ 4 = 67.5. So statement A is correct. Statement B uses an incomplete total, statement C gives a wrong total, and statement D reverses the comparison because Thursday's 90 is greater than Wednesday's 75 by 15. Therefore, the only correct statement is that the average was 67.5 books per day.

Q3A shop recorded the sale of notebooks over four days: Monday 120, Tuesday 150, Wednesday 135, and Thursday 165. Which of the following statements is correct?

A The average sale per day was 142.5 notebooks.
B The average sale per day was 150 notebooks.
C The total sale over four days was 540 notebooks.
D Wednesday's sale was 30 notebooks more than Monday's sale.
Explanation

First add the four daily sales: 120 + 150 + 135 + 165 = 570 notebooks. The average sale per day is total sale divided by the number of days. So, average = 570 ÷ 4 = 142.5 notebooks. The total is not 540, and Wednesday's sale exceeds Monday's by 135 − 120 = 15, not 30. Therefore, the only correct statement is that the average sale per day was 142.5 notebooks.

Q4The table shows the number of candidates selected from four districts in a CET practice drive: Jaipur 120, Jodhpur 90, Kota 60 and Ajmer 30. What percentage of the total selected candidates came from Jaipur?

A 40%
B 30%
C 50%
D 25%
Explanation

First find the total number of selected candidates. Total = 120 + 90 + 60 + 30 = 300. The percentage from Jaipur is calculated as Jaipur candidates ÷ total candidates × 100. Therefore, percentage = 120 ÷ 300 × 100 = 0.4 × 100 = 40%. The question asks for Jaipur's share in the whole group, so the denominator must be the total of all four districts, not any single district or partial total. Hence the correct answer is 40%.

Q5A fruit seller sold 40 apples, 60 bananas, and 50 oranges in one morning. Match each fruit with its percentage share in the total sale: Apples, Bananas, Oranges.

A Apples - 26 2/3%, Bananas - 40%, Oranges - 33 1/3%
B Apples - 40%, Bananas - 26 2/3%, Oranges - 33 1/3%
C Apples - 25%, Bananas - 40%, Oranges - 35%
D Apples - 33 1/3%, Bananas - 40%, Oranges - 26 2/3%
Explanation

First find the total fruit sale: 40 + 60 + 50 = 150 fruits. Percentage share = item count ÷ total count × 100. Apples = 40 ÷ 150 × 100 = 26 2/3%. Bananas = 60 ÷ 150 × 100 = 40%. Oranges = 50 ÷ 150 × 100 = 33 1/3%. These three percentages add to 100%, so the matching is complete. Therefore, the correct matching is Apples - 26 2/3%, Bananas - 40%, Oranges - 33 1/3%.
